Sheila Pitambar is trapped between two conflicting realities.
She wakes up every morning with the echo of her Diya’s words. ‘Damned if I do, Damned if I don’t’. For some reason it terrifies her.
In the living reality, she is labelled insane because she believes her daughter was conceived in one reality and born in another.
In the erased reality, a pregnant Sheila had saved the world from an ancient devourer of planets, in the bargain losing the man she loved.
Divorced and cast aside, Sheila must again confront the evil clawing its way into this world.
As if by the hands of destiny, Sheila comes across others who had battled the evil in the erased reality.
They believe the world will end unless Sheila allies with the man they call the extraordinary cripple. After all, he is the key to the Gudem Experiment.
